Transaction 3b65bd4eb32fdbba1ebc9a933fd9148585fc59068e786f6159affda31d6d3ae2

1 Input
2 Outputs
  • 3b65bd4eb32fdbba1ebc9a933fd9148585fc59068e786f6159affda31d6d3ae2:0
  • value  26912211
    address  3Nq4NepkZrydz884GFBZMdEzG7j4GMWVcx
  • 3b65bd4eb32fdbba1ebc9a933fd9148585fc59068e786f6159affda31d6d3ae2:1
  • value  134504
    address  1HbMMERdP2wb6KkKWUwAExv6wmSChSms1Y